Itinerary and Locations

The Mallorca day trip visits several picturesque beaches, including Cala Llombards, Calo des Moro, and Cala Salmunia. Participants are picked up from select locations like Cala Millor, Alcúdia, and Palma, and are later dropped off at the same spots after the tour.
| Beach | Duration | Activities |
|---|---|---|
| Cala Llombards | 2 hours | Visit, Swimming, Snorkeling |
| Calo des Moro | 2 hours | Visit, Swimming, Snorkeling |
| Cala Salmunia | 2 hours | Visit, Snorkeling |
The tour provides access to secluded beaches not easily reachable by public transport, allowing guests to fully enjoy the stunning natural landscapes of Mallorca.
Included Amenities

Comfortable van transport to and from the beaches, snorkeling gear, paddle surfboards, GoPro cameras, and beach games are among the amenities provided on this Mallorca day trip.
Plus, a cooler with ice for a picnic, umbrellas, and rock shoes are included to enhance the overall experience. This ensures participants can fully enjoy the stunning natural surroundings without worrying about equipment or supplies.

Beaches Visited

Cala Llombards, Calo des Moro, and Cala Salmunia are the three stunning beaches visitors explore during the day trip.
At each location, they’ll have 2 hours to swim, snorkel, and enjoy the picturesque Mediterranean scenery.
Cala Llombards offers a chance to try optional paddleboarding, while Cala Salmunia features a unique opportunity to jump into a cave.
The tour provides snorkeling gear, so guests can easily explore the vibrant marine life.
Each beach offers a secluded, untouched ambiance that’s difficult to access without a guided tour.
